Achieving Operational Excellence in Pharmaceutical Manufacturing

July 1, 2017

It is no secret that the pharmaceutical industry is feeling intense pressure to transform their operations and the way that they do business around the world. Institutions that have manufactured products the same way for decades are now being forced to reduce costs, add value and turn production into a competitive advantage.

Utility Trailer Manufacturing Company is America's oldest privately owned, family-operated trailer manufacturer. Founded in 1914, our company designs and manufactures dry freight vans, flatbeds, refrigerated vans, and Tautliner® curtainsided trailers. We are the largest producer of refrigerated vans and the third largest trailer manufacturer in the United States. Utility currently operates five trailer factories across the United States: two for refrigerated trailers located in Marion, Virginia, and Clearfield, Utah, two for dry vans located in Glade Spring, Virginia, and Paragould, Arkansas, and a flatbed and Tautliner® factory in Enterprise, Alabama. Shaping the Future of Formulation Development with Melt-based 3D Printing Technologies

whitePaper | June 6, 2021

Three-dimensional (3D) printing is a powerful technology that has wide-ranging applications, including many in the pharmaceutical industry. Among the approaches that are being explored in the production of pharmaceutical dosage forms powder-based systems which utilize either drop-on-powder or selective laser sintering and liquid-based systems which use dropon-drop deposition or stereolithography are frequently applied. With liquid-based technology, either UV, laser energy or high temperature is used to induce polymerization and build the 3D structure.1 The process of 3D printing offers the potential to produce medications tailored to the needs of patients and dosage forms in various shapes, sizes and textures with different release profiles that can be difficult to produce using conventional techniques.2
